#e5f1c5 basic color information

#e5f1c5

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#e5f1c5 has decimal index of: 15069637, is composed of 89.8% red, 94.5% green and 77.3% blue. #e5f1c5 in CMYK color model, is composed of 5%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.3% yellow and 5.5% black.
#ccffcc is the closest web-safe color to #e5f1c5.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
